Texas Governor Defies Biden Administration in Escalating Border Dispute

Abbott's Assertion of State's Right to Self-Defense Sparks Controversy, Highlights Ongoing Challenge to Federal Control of Immigration

Overview

  • Texas Governor Greg Abbott has declared his state's constitutional authority to defend itself against what he terms an 'invasion' of migrants, in defiance of the Biden administration's immigration policies.
  • The Supreme Court recently ruled 5-4 to temporarily overturn a lower court’s injunction which banned the federal government from cutting razor fencing Texas had installed along the border near Eagle Pass.
  • Abbott's assertion of Texas' right to self-defense has been met with widespread support from Republican governors and politicians, but has been criticized by legal scholars and Democrats as unconstitutional and a usurping of federal authority.
  • Despite the Supreme Court ruling, Texas law enforcement continues to install additional razor wire along the border, leading to a standoff with federal officials.
  • The escalating border dispute is part of Texas' ongoing efforts to challenge federal control of immigration and border enforcement, with potential implications for future Supreme Court cases.
